Higher Rates for Longer? Mortgage Debt & The Great Renewal
It has been termed “the great renewal”. A significant number of Canadian mortgages are coming up for renewal. By one account, around 2.2 million mortgages or 45 percent of all outstanding mortgages, are set to face higher interest rates this year and next.1 Even though the Bank of Canada cut interest rates in 2024 as inflation continues […]
Financial Resolutions: Resolve to Review Your Will
If you are looking for a financial resolution to start the year, why not make estate planning a priority? Every so often we hear stories about the consequences of not having a valid will. To die without one, known as dying “intestate”, can have significant and perhaps unintended effects as assets will be distributed according […]

While many aspects of investing in the equity markets may seem unpredictable, one constant remains: volatility. Just how common are market fluctuations? Even in years when the S&P/TSX Composite Index has performed well, we should expect substantial volatility. Over the past 40 years, despite average annual performance of more than 6 percent, the average intra-year […]
